Topics Covered

  1. 1. Wind Energy Basics: Learners will study the fundamentals of wind energy, including wind turbine technology, aerodynamics, and meteorology. They will gain an understanding of how wind turbines generate electricity and the environmental benefits of wind energy.
  2. 2. Data Collection and Management: This module covers the methods and tools for collecting and managing data from wind farms, including sensors, SCADA systems, and data logging techniques. Learners will learn how to configure and troubleshoot these systems to ensure accurate data collection.
  3. 3. Data Analysis Fundamentals: Learners will explore basic statistical methods and data analysis techniques to process and interpret wind farm data. They will gain skills in using spreadsheet software and basic programming languages for data manipulation and visualization.
  4. 4. Turbine Performance Metrics: This module focuses on defining and calculating key performance metrics for wind turbines, such as capacity factor, specific energy production, and availability. Learners will learn how to use these metrics to assess turbine performance and identify areas for improvement.
  5. 5. Advanced Data Analysis Techniques: Building on foundational skills, learners will delve into more advanced data analysis techniques, including machine learning and predictive modeling. They will learn how to apply these techniques to optimize wind farm performance and forecast energy production.
  6. 6. Wind Farm Maintenance and Reliability: This module covers the importance of maintenance in ensuring wind farm reliability and longevity. Learners will study maintenance strategies, condition monitoring systems, and predictive maintenance techniques to reduce downtime and optimize operational efficiency.
  7. 7. Wind Farm Operations and Management: Learners will explore the principles of wind farm operations and management, including project management, financial analysis, and stakeholder communication. They will gain skills in developing operational plans and managing teams effectively.
  8. 8. Case Studies in Wind Farm Optimization: Through real-world case studies, learners will apply their knowledge to actual wind farm scenarios, analyzing performance data and implementing strategies to optimize farm operations and profitability.
  9. 9. Regulatory and Environmental Considerations: This module covers the regulatory frameworks and environmental guidelines affecting wind farm operations. Learners will learn how to navigate these requirements to ensure compliance and minimize environmental impact.
  10. 10. Wind Farm Design and Optimization: This advanced module focuses on the design and optimization of new wind farms. Learners will study site selection, layout optimization, and turbine selection, as well as techniques for integrating wind farms into the grid to maximize efficiency and reduce costs.
